Job 15:34 — Bible Verse (KJV)
“For the congregation of hypocrites shall be desolate, and fire shall consume the tabernacles of bribery.”

Job 15:34 in Context — Job 15
32 It shall be accomplished before his time, and his branch shall not be green.
33 He shall shake off his unripe grape as the vine, and shall cast off his flower as the olive.
34 For the congregation of hypocrites shall be desolate, and fire shall consume the tabernacles of bribery.
35 They conceive mischief, and bring forth vanity, and their belly prepareth deceit.
